Annaly Capital Management (NYSE:NLY) Price Target Raised to $22.00 at JPMorgan Chase & Co.

Annaly Capital Management (NYSE:NLYGet Free Report) had its target price lifted by equities research analysts at JPMorgan Chase & Co. from $21.00 to $22.00 in a research report issued on Thursday, Benzinga reports. The firm currently has an “overweight” rating on the real estate investment trust’s stock. JPMorgan Chase & Co.‘s target price would indicate a potential upside of 8.48% from the company’s current price.

About Annaly Capital Management

(Get Free Report)

Annaly Capital Management, Inc, a diversified capital manager, engages in mortgage finance. The company invests in agency mortgage-backed securities collateralized by residential mortgages; non-agency residential whole loans and securitized products within the residential and commercial markets; mortgage servicing rights; agency commercial mortgage-backed securities; to-be-announced forward contracts; residential mortgage loans; and agency or private label credit risk transfer securities.
